Job Duties

  • Greet guests with a smile in a timely and professional manner
  • possess full knowledge of bar and menu items and make recommendations
  • accurately record food and beverage orders from guests in a timely manner
  • verify identification to confirm guests are at least 21 years of age for all alcohol transactions
  • ensure that alcohol is consumed in designated areas only
  • consistently use suggestive selling techniques
  • collaborate with kitchen team to ensure that food orders are accurate
  • deliver food and beverage orders within established time frames
  • process payment for completed guest orders
  • maintain appropriate stock levels for the bar
  • assist the general manager on duty with placing orders for all liquor and bar related supplies
  • consistently wipe down and sanitize employee and guest high-contact areas
  • properly utilize personal protective equipment while completing position specific tasks
  • adapt to the frequency and scope of required cleaning tasks
  • monitor safety and security issues and report issues to management
